Valentina Tortorella

Valentina Tortorella

Professor

Italian Freelance Accessories Designer based in Paris.

Education
Fashion Degree at Marangoni Fashion Institute, Milan

Professional experience
Luxury and High End Fashion at Giangranco Ferré, for Men/Women Shoe Collections (shoe design and development.) Joined Louis Vuitton as Leather Goods Designer for Men and Women Ranges to learn and practice the fundamentals of Industrial Luxury, exploring the logics of Design Identity and Craftsmanship at Industrial Scale. Worked as Head of Men Leather Goods Design Studio under Marc Jacobs Artistic Direction to explore the boundaries of LV’s Heritage for several Years; in charge of material researches driven by technological and environmental issues at the Direction of Innovation of Louis Vuitton, whilst founding and directing own brand «Ragazze Ornamentali» for a new non ostentatious vision of femininity based on craftsmanship and time travelling aesthetics.

Awards
Talents du Luxe et de la Creation 2011 by Elle and Ministry of French Culture; Finalist at Who’s on Next by organised by Franca Sozzani and Italian Vogue in collaboration with Suzy Menkes. Head of Leather Goods at Alexander McQueen, London.

Teaching experience
Head Genève, IFM and ENSCI; as Jury member and Faculty at Parsons Paris. Invited Lecturer at Beijing Fashion Forum.
